Political cartoonist Thomas Nast based his drawings of Uncle Sam on Rice and his costume. Dan Rice was an accomplished animal fitness instructor. He specialized in pigs and mules, which he trained and sold to various other clowns. He additionally provided an act with a qualified rhinoceros and is the only individual in circus history to provide a tightrope strolling elephant.


He was likewise a benefactor who provided kindly to numerous charities and he erected the first monolith to soldiers eliminated during the Civil War - Corporate event ideas Dallas. Beginnings of the Auguste characterThere is an extensively told tale about the origins of the Auguste clown. According to the tale, an American acrobat called Tom Belling was carrying out with a circus in Germany in 1869


The manager all of a sudden entered the room. Belling removed running, winding up in the circus sector where he fell over the ringcurb. In his shame and haste to get away, he tipped over the ringcurb again on his escape. The audience yelled, "auguste!" which is German for fool. The supervisor commanded that Belling continue looking like the Auguste.

No one understands where the mummers' plays and Morris dances originated from. In such plays there is a collection of personalities consisting of "kings" and "saints", cross-dressing, and blackface duties; the faces of Morris (or "Moorish") dancers were also blackened. The mummer's plays were not for fun. The majority of were carried out by paupers in the hungry time after Xmas.


If rejected, they would rake the wrongdoer's backyard. The Derby Play of the Tup was performed for food and beer by jobless youths. This use of blackface for political activity camouflaged as home entertainment continued America when the offspring of these guys blackened their faces to oppose taxes. One such protest has entered American history as the Boston Tea Ceremony.
